Ballast water treatment is the process of treating ballast water in order to actively remove, kill and/or inactivate organisms prior to discharge. Ballast water treatment is different from the older process of ballast water exchange, which involved completely flushing the ballast water tanks during voyages.

Composite cruising ballast water treatment process

InactiveCN101428919AAddressing Spread ContaminationSolve off-site hazardsElectrolysis componentsWater/sewage treatmentSuspended particlesElectrolysis
The invention belongs to the technical field of ballast water treatment in the shipping process, and relates to a composite ship ballast water treatment method. The method comprises two steps of high-efficiency filtration and inactivation treatment by a reinjection electrolysis process; the high-efficiency filtration is to serially connect a filter to an output port, through which the ballast water is loaded into a ship ballast tank, of a ballast pump to remove pelagic organisms and suspended particles; the rated flow of the filter is the same as the flow of the ballast water; the inactivation treatment by the reinjection electrolysis method is that when the ballast water is loaded, a booster pump is used to extract partial ballast water from a water inlet manifold at an outlet end of the filter to flow through an electrolytic tank, and chloride ions are oxidized on a positive electrode of the electrolytic tank to generate chlorine to be dissolved in the ballast water to generate sodium hypochlorite; and the sodium hypochlorite solution is reinjected into the water inlet manifold by the booster pump to be mixed evenly to ensure that the concentration of the sodium hypochlorite realizes the killing to residual harmful aquatic organisms. The method has the advantages of simple process route, reliable principle, and good treatment effect.

Physical-means-based ballast water treatment equipment

InactiveCN102101705AIncreased range of turbidity adaptationEffective Flow Field DesignWater/sewage treatment by irradiationNature of treatment waterUltrasonic sensorControl system
The invention relates to the technical field of ship ballast water treatment equipment, in particular to physical-means-based ballast water treatment equipment, which comprises a backwash filter and an ultraviolet and ultrasonic wave combined treater. Ballast water is pumped into a water inlet of the backwash filter by a ballast pump, is treated, and enters the combined treater for treatment; andthe combined treater comprises a shell with an annular channel, ultraviolet lamps annularly arranged in the annular channel, and an ultrasonic transducer positioned in the center of the annular channel. The combined treater consists of the high-power ultraviolet lamps arranged annularly and the ultrasonic transducer positioned in the center, the ballast water which is filtered and supplied with oxygen enters the combined treater along the tangential direction of the shell of the treater, spirally flows in the treater, and fully contacts the treatment field consisting of the ultraviolet lamps and the ultrasonic waves to meet the specified treatment requirement. An automatic detection and control system can automatically adjust the output energy of the ultraviolet lamps and the ultrasonic waves according to difference of water quality so as to achieve energy-saving optimal configuration.

On-line anti-fouling ship ballast water treatment system and ship ballast water treatment method

The invention provides an on-line anti-fouling ship ballast water treatment system which comprises a ballast water main pipeline, a ballast water branch pipeline, a chemicals feeding pipeline, a filter, an electrolysis unit and a chemicals feeding pump, wherein the filter is positioned on the ballast water main pipeline, the electrolysis unit is positioned on the ballast water branch pipeline, the chemicals feeding pump is positioned on the chemicals feeding pipeline, part of seawater of the ship ballast water treatment system is introduced and filtered by the filter and then flows to the ballast water branch pipeline and the electrolysis unit, the part of the seawater which is electrolyzed by the electrolysis unit is reinjected to the filter through the chemicals feeding pump and the chemicals feeding pipeline after a ballast process is completed, and the part of the seawater is kept in the filter for a certain time. According to the on-line anti-fouling ship ballast water treatment system, after the ballast process is completed, a TRO solution obtained by electrolysis treatment of the seawater is reinjected to the filter and is kept in the filter until the next ballast process is started, so that the growth and propagation of marine organisms in the filter can be inhibited by sodium hypochlorite contained in the TRO solution when a ballast pump stops operating. In addition, the invention further provides an on-line anti-fouling ship ballast water treatment method.
